The Chemistry of Why Goat Milk Supports a Soft Skin Surface
Why This Matters
Most people don’t realize that the cleansing step is the number‑one moment where moisture loss occurs. Even gentle water-based cleansers can disrupt the skin’s surface lipids. A well‑formulated goat milk and tallow soap protects these lipids during washing, helping the skin stay soft, comfortable, and balanced throughout the day.
Goat milk is one of the most effective, biologically active ingredients used in traditional soapmaking. Rather than acting as a simple moisture filler, it naturally contains a balanced matrix of creamy fats, mild alpha-hydroxy acids, and natural nutrients that preserve the skin's surface smoothness during cleansing.
1. High-Density Triglycerides and Butterfats
The natural butterfats in goat milk contain complex fat globules that contribute to a soft, heavily cushioned lather. This structural creaminess acts as a physical, smooth buffer between your hands and the skin, significantly reducing the mechanical friction that often causes discomfort or tightness during washing.
2. Skin-Compatible Fatty Acid Profiles
Goat milk is exceptionally rich in medium-chain fatty acids, specifically capric, caprylic, and lauric acids. These lipids exhibit a molecular structure that matches the fatty acids naturally present in the outer layers of human skin. This allows the soap to lift away surface debris while leaving baseline moisture completely intact.
3. Natural Lactic Acid for Non-Frictional Smoothing
Sensitive skin types frequently struggle with a rough, uneven accumulation of dry flakes, yet physical scrubs are far too abrasive. Goat milk naturally supplies lactic acid, a mild alpha-hydroxy acid (AHA). Lactic acid gently softens and dissolves dull surface accumulation without the need for rough physical scrubbing. Furthermore, lactic acid functions as a natural humectant, pulling ambient moisture onto the newly smoothed skin surface.
Why Our Entire Line Is Anchored by a Tallow Base
While goat milk delivers superior creaminess and nutrients, 100% grass-fed tallow forms the structural foundation of our soap. From an ingredient perspective, common mass-market plant oils (like palm, soy, or corn) cannot replicate the precise fatty acid footprint that human skin requires to feel truly comfortable after a wash.

1. Sebum Realism via Saturated Fatty Acids
Healthy human skin oils (sebum) are composed largely of specific fats that protect our skin from drying out. Tallow shares an extraordinarily similar lipid profile, delivering a powerful combination of:
- Palmitic & Stearic Acids: Dense, structural lipids that coat the skin surface, helping keep vital moisture from evaporating post-wash.
- Oleic Acid: A deeply moisturizing omega-9 fatty acid that enhances softness and completely prevents that stiff, dry "tightness" after rinsing.
2. Dense, Heavy-Bubbled Micro-Lather
The high presence of stearic acid gives our bars an exceptionally firm physical profile. When used, it creates a dense, micro-bubble lather that doesn't instantly collapse. This thick cushion ensures a low-detergent, high-glide cleanse that leaves the skin feeling supple rather than stripped.
3. Unmatched Durability and Performance
Tallow produces an inherently harder, longer-lasting bar of soap that avoids waterlogging or melting into mush in the shower tray. This allows our extra-large 6oz bars to preserve their rich lipid profiles from the very first use down to the last sliver.
